Book nook representing the meme of the moment: The Nihilist Penguin. Based on Werner Herzog's 2007 Encounters at the End of the World.
The penguin is printing separately, and there are two versions: single color (full black) or multicolor (black and white) AMS required. The penguin is so small and its wings so thin that is very fragile, so please be very careful when removing the wing supports. If a wing gets broken, dont worry and print it again, its only 2 grams of filament (be more cautious next time)
The rest of the booknook is printed in a single piece, with 3 diferent versions to chose from:
- Plain background with no text.
- “But WHY?” at the background. Multicolor option available (AMS not required if you are patient enough to set pauses and manually change filament between the colored layers for the text)
- “They survived, HE LIVED” at the background. Also available in multicolor for text.
Feel free to try any other multicolor configuration.
